Description

Little Lantern Rayflower is an excellent perennial choice for Massachusetts gardeners looking to add bold summer color and texture to their landscapes. It produces golden-yellow flower spikes atop dark green, serrated foliage and rich purple stems from mid to late summer. The flowers look especially striking when planted near water features or in the middle of mixed borders.

Thriving in moist, well-drained soil, Little Lantern Rayflower is easy to grow in Massachusetts and makes a reliable seasonal focal point. Its bold form is deer-resistant and low maintenance, requiring just a spring trim to stay healthy. Little Lantern Rayflower also adds visual interest to bog gardens and mass plantings.

Plant Specs:

Botanical Name: Ligularia 'Little Lantern'
Color: yellow
Light: part sun – full shade
Watering: 1 – 2 times per week while becoming established
Soil: moist, rich
Zone: 4 – 8

Plant Shape: upright spreading
Plant Type: herbaceous perennial
Mature Size: height (24″), width (30″)
Blooming Season: mid – late summer
Growth Rate: medium
